State of Franklin road in Johnson City TN- this crossing features 2 modern industries cantilevers with US&S 12X20 inch and 12X24 inch incandescent lights (which used to have bags on them but were removed because they were completely rotted) and 2 US&S mechanical bells. This crossing was owned by the East Tennessee railway and Norfolk Southern used to back some cars all the way down to their small yard up until about 15 years ago, now they drop them off at another part of their line, leaving it abandoned 5393 coeburn Rd (VA 72) near Coeburn VA (on Google Earth it says it's in coeburn but it's technically just outside of the town limits)- this crossing is very interesting. It's on a small Branch line that was originally owned by the L&N and then went into CSX's ownership until about a decade ago when the only customer on the line shut down. This crossing features a pair of gateless signals the first one replaced the original signal in the late 90s, it has a safetran base, 3 pairs of safetran 12x24 inch lights and what appears to be a general signals type 1 electronic bell. And the more interesting signal is a us&s cantilever from I believe the 1960s, 4 pairs of us&s 8 inch lights and a US&S TEARDROP BELL sadly it doesn't ring these days Hopefully these can be included in part 9
